英文简介
Dr. Kent Su is Lecturer at Shanghai International Studies University, where his research focuses on modernist poetry and art, ecology, Chinese philosophical traditions, comparative literature, and transnational studies. He earned his BA in English Literature and History from the University of British Columbia and his MA and PhD in English Literature from University College London. His forthcoming monograph, Ezra Pound and Chinese Landscapes (Clemson University Press, 2026), explores the philosophical evocation of Chinese landscapes in Ezra Pound’s poetry. Dr. Su co-organizes the London Cantos Reading Group and has published widely in journals such as Neohelicon, Notes & Queries, Textual Practice, The Literary Encyclopaedia, and Life Writing.
